Abstract
This paper is concerned with the numerical analysis of propagation characteristics of electromagnetic waves traveling along two-dimensional (2D) random rough surface (RRS). Ray searching algorithm is based on 2D discrete ray tracing method (DRTM), and the field distribution corresponding to each searched ray is computed by using source and image diffraction coefficients. Numerical computations are carried out for total field distributions along RRS as well as the delay profiles at an arbitrary observation point which is far from a source antenna. Detailed discussions are made on the effect of directivity of a source or a receive antenna to the delay spreads of received powers.
